dc.description.abstractIn this thesis, a new feeding method for exciting small-size USB dongle is proposed. A new feeding structure is designed on a thin line of USB connector to fully cover Bluetooth and Wi-Fi services. The simulation of the proposed antenna has a bandwidth of 160 MHz, from 2376 MHz to 2536 MHz with a voltage standing wave ratio of 2. The designed antenna consists of a feeding line, a capacitor (C), an inductor (L), and a ground plane. The basis for radiating USB dongle is to form a resonating structure on a thin line of USB terminal where current is strong and to use the ground plane of USB dongle as a radiator. The antenna is designed on a FR-4 substrate (ε_r= 4.4, tan δ = 0.02) and occupies an area of 3×5mm^2. A new feeding structure was designed on a thin line which is the USB ground port of a USB dongle, and it does not require additional clearance area for antenna structure.-
